Optimal Stats for End-Game Staff and Wand Users
Beyond the specific types of items, understanding which stats are most beneficial is crucial for optimizing your end-game build. The priority stats will vary based on the game and your selected role. Some of the most impactful stats to prioritize include:
- Spell Power/Magic Damage: The primary stat for increasing the damage output of spells.
- Critical Hit Chance: Increases the likelihood of landing a critical hit.
- Critical Hit Damage: Increases the damage of critical hits.
- Spellcasting Speed: Reduces the time it takes to cast spells, allowing you to fire off more spells in a shorter period of time.
- Mana Regeneration: Determines how quickly you recover mana, allowing you to sustain casting.
- Mana Pool: Dictates how much mana you can have available, allowing for longer casting periods.
- Elemental Damage Boosts: Enhances the damage of specific elemental types.
- Specific Skill Boosts: Increases the potency of specific spells or skills.
It’s essential to find a balance among these stats that aligns with your specific build and play style. For example, a build focused on maximizing damage output might prioritize critical hit chance and damage as opposed to a mana-focused build, that will benefit more from Mana Regeneration and Mana Pool.

Optimizing Your End-Game Gear: Synergies and Tactics
Acquiring the best gear is just half the battle. Optimizing how you use it is also very important. Here are some tips for maximizing the effectiveness of your end-game staff or wand:
- Synergize Your Stats: Choose gear whose stats complement each other and your skill tree, maximizing overall performance. For example, a higher crit chance can also mean that you need higher crit damage to maximize the effect of a critical hit.
- Test Multiple Builds: Don’t be afraid to experiment with different gear combinations and builds. This can help you find what works best for your play style.
- Analyze Combat Logs: Many games provide combat logs that can help you analyze your performance. Use this information to identify areas for improvement.
- Learn the Game Meta: Keep up with the game’s meta and player community as the game is constantly being patched and changes are introduced constantly. What works one day may not work the next day.
